Subject: [PATCH 1/2] dt-bindings: hwmon: national,lm90: Fix channel constraints for temperature offset
Date: Mon, 24 Aug 2026 21:38:59 +0300 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20260824183900.8983-2-flaviu.nistor@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20260824183900.8983-1-flaviu.nistor@gmail.com>
Limit temperature-offset-millicelsius to remote channels only, since
channel 0 is local and this property does not apply to it.
Channel 2 is only valid on devices with two remote sensors, so reject
channel 2 for compatibles that do not support a second remote channel.
